def Download(url):
"""Download a file to a temporary directory
Args:
url: URL to download
Returns:
Tuple:
Temporary directory name
Full path to the downloaded archive file in that directory,
or None if there was an error while downloading
"""
print('Downloading: %s' % url)
leaf = url.split('/')[-1]
tmpdir = tempfile.mkdtemp('.buildman')
response = urllib.request.urlopen(url)
fname = os.path.join(tmpdir, leaf)
fd = open(fname, 'wb')
meta = response.info()
size = int(meta.get('Content-Length'))
done = 0
block_size = 1 << 16
status = ''
# Read the file in chunks and show progress as we go
while True:
buffer = response.read(block_size)
if not buffer:
print(chr(8) * (len(status) + 1), '\r', end=' ')
break
done += len(buffer)
fd.write(buffer)
status = r'%10d MiB [%3d%%]' % (done // 1024 // 1024,
done * 100 // size)
status = status + chr(8) * (len(status) + 1)
print(status, end=' ')
sys.stdout.flush()
fd.close()
if done != size:
print('Error, failed to download')
os.remove(fname)
fname = None
return tmpdir, fname
